// Structure used for on-the-fly rescaling typedef uint32_t rescaler_t; // type for side-buffer typedefstruct WebPRescaler WebPRescaler; struct WebPRescaler { int x_expand; // true if we're expanding in the x direction int y_expand; // true if we're expanding in the y direction int num_channels; // bytes to jump between pixels
uint32_t fx_scale; // fixed-point scaling factors
uint32_t fy_scale; // ''
uint32_t fxy_scale; // '' int y_accum; // vertical accumulator int y_add, y_sub; // vertical increments int x_add, x_sub; // horizontal increments int src_width, src_height; // source dimensions int dst_width, dst_height; // destination dimensions int src_y, dst_y; // row counters for input and output
uint8_t* dst; int dst_stride;
rescaler_t* irow, *frow; // work buffer
};
// Initialize a rescaler given scratch area 'work' and dimensions of src & dst. // Returns false in case of error. int WebPRescalerInit(WebPRescaler* const rescaler, int src_width, int src_height,
uint8_t* const dst, int dst_width, int dst_height, int dst_stride, int num_channels,
rescaler_t* const work);
// If either 'scaled_width' or 'scaled_height' (but not both) is 0 the value // will be calculated preserving the aspect ratio, otherwise the values are // left unmodified. Returns true on success, false if either value is 0 after // performing the scaling calculation. int WebPRescalerGetScaledDimensions(int src_width, int src_height, int* const scaled_width, int* const scaled_height);
// Returns the number of input lines needed next to produce one output line, // considering that the maximum available input lines are 'max_num_lines'. int WebPRescaleNeededLines(const WebPRescaler* const rescaler, int max_num_lines);
// Import multiple rows over all channels, until at least one row is ready to // be exported. Returns the actual number of lines that were imported. int WebPRescalerImport(WebPRescaler* const rescaler, int num_rows, const uint8_t* src, int src_stride);
// Export as many rows as possible. Return the numbers of rows written. int WebPRescalerExport(WebPRescaler* const rescaler);
// Return true if input is finished static WEBP_INLINE int WebPRescalerInputDone(const WebPRescaler* const rescaler) { return (rescaler->src_y >= rescaler->src_height);
} // Return true if output is finished static WEBP_INLINE int WebPRescalerOutputDone(const WebPRescaler* const rescaler) { return (rescaler->dst_y >= rescaler->dst_height);
}
// Return true if there are pending output rows ready. static WEBP_INLINE int WebPRescalerHasPendingOutput(const WebPRescaler* const rescaler) { return !WebPRescalerOutputDone(rescaler) && (rescaler->y_accum <= 0);
}
